State Government’s authority to prescribe higher qualifications than those set by NCTE for the appointment of teachers upheld.

 

Ratio –

Therefore, in our conscious view, merely the petitioners who have cleared Mathematics and Science subject in TET without having said subjects in their degree course, have no right in their favour and there is no bar under the provisions of Right to Education Act for prescribing qualification higher than the qualification prescribed by the NCTE. Therefore, in our judicious conscience, qualification for appointment to the post of Teacher is under the domain of experts and this Court cannot interfere in the same while prescribing required qualification. In view of the above, the present petition is liable to be dismissed. Hence, we proceed to pass the following order:

ORDER

I) Writ Petition is dismissed. No costs.

II) Rule is discharged
